At Overflow Recovery Support Services, Inc., we believe community healing is built through collaboration. We partner with professionals, educators, and community leaders who share our vision of supporting recovery, wellness, and personal growth in Sequoyah County and beyond.
_______________________________________________________________________
We welcome a variety of providers, including:
Licensed mental health professionals
Peer recovery support specialists
Faith-based leaders and ministries
Cherokee Nation educators and service providers
Wellness instructors (yoga, mindfulness, nutrition, etc.)
Artists, crafters, and community educators
If your work promotes healing, growth, or recovery — there’s a place for you here.
_______________________________________________________________________
As a facilitator, you can host:
Recovery meetings or support groups
Educational classes and workshops
Faith-based or spiritual gatherings
Arts, crafts, and creative wellness sessions
Outreach or resource-sharing events
All programs hosted at Overflow should reflect our mission of bridging the gap with hope, healing, and community.
